ROW | Webinar – Defining wellbeing – what is it really, how do we measure it, and where are we going as a profession?

Free | Wed 30 March 2022, 12pm – 1pm (NZST)

Overview:

For our next webinar, we are delighted to be joined by Chris Jones, Chief Safety and Wellbeing Officer at Ara Poutama Department of Corrections. Join us as we try to define what wellbeing actually is (and what it isn’t), how we can create the right systems and conditions that allow wellbeing to emerge, and how we can best attempt to quantify those factors in an effort to measure success.

We’ll also be discussing the emergence of wellbeing as a profession, and the opportunity we have to grow and shape it in the coming years.
